Overview
This bill clarifies the definition of ‘prohibited weapon’ under Alaska law. It expands the list of weapons considered prohibited to include specific types of explosives, devices designed to muffle firearm reports, rifles and shotguns with short barrels, and devices designed to convert handguns into automatic weapons. The changes will take effect after the bill is passed and signed into law.
